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Amazon weasel | Macroalgae |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(动物界) | Plantae (植物) |
| Phylum | Chordata (脊索动物门) | Chlorophyta (綠藻門) |
| Class | Mammalia (哺乳動物) | Ulvophyceae (石蓴綱) |
| Order | Carnivora (食肉目) | Bryopsidales (羽藻目) |
| Family | Mustelidae (Weasels & Otters) | Caulerpaceae |
| Genus | Mustela | Caulerpa |
| Species | Mustela africana | Caulerpa brachypus |
